Your brain learns to expect study at a fixed time. Even 45 minutes daily beats 5 hours once a week.
Don't copy word for word. Rewriting forces your brain to actually understand the content.
JAMB, WAEC and GT assessments all repeat patterns. Past questions are your best preparation.
You forget 70% of what you learn within a day if you don't review it. Read your notes again the next morning.
Just having your phone visible reduces your brain's capacity. Keep it in another room during study time.
Explaining a topic to someone else is the fastest way to find gaps in your understanding.
Your brain is 75% water. Even mild dehydration reduces concentration and memory by up to 20%.
Your brain consolidates everything you studied while you sleep. Cutting sleep to study more hurts you.
Study one topic at a time, master it, quiz yourself, then move on. Don't rush the whole subject.
After completing a study session, do something you enjoy. This trains your brain to enjoy studying.
Assign specific subjects to specific days. A plan removes the mental effort of deciding what to study.
